Output b622cdd7bc0cc9c1e768b50de0d0d7ee4d29fd38673679d03e3840bb2ca58cd6:3

value
23676032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755d4ff8d1b65f548ae0daece41de5611b4ba0a4 OP_EQUAL
address
MJbj5LG7pbC24uMLgL64ofswrz6kmjUfWq
transaction
b622cdd7bc0cc9c1e768b50de0d0d7ee4d29fd38673679d03e3840bb2ca58cd6
spent
true